Carragher, Neville, Keane and Wright all predict Spurs vs Aston Villa score

Gary Neville, Jamie Carragher, Roy Kean and Ian Wright  expect Aston Villa to turn over Spurs at the Tottenham Hotspur Stadium on Sunday.

Ange Postecoglou’s men need a response after falling to two back-to-back defeats to Wolves and Chelsea just before the international break.

While Tottenham are without several key players, with Cristian Romero suspended, and with James Maddison and Micky van de Ven recently joining the long-term injury absentees, they will take heart from their home form.

The Lilywhites have a perfect record at home this season barring the London derby against Chelsea, where they had two players sent off.

This game has been billed by some as a potential six-pointer, with pundits backing Villa and Spurs to battle it out for a Champions League spot this season (talkSPORT).

Pundits predict a Tottenham defeat this weekend

Tottenham fans will not be too encouraged by the predictions of the various pundits on The Overlap YouTube channel.

While Wright and Keane both went for Villa to edge out Spurs 2-1, Neville and Carragher believe that Unai Emery’s side will emerge comfortable 3-1 winners.
